<p>In Mr Entertainment , we hear the voices of the people who knew Taliep Petersen best: his family, friends and collaborators. Their stories bring to life the spaces he inhabited, vividly recounting scenes from his childhood, his rise to fame from the Cape Coon Carnival stage to the West End, his artistic collaborations, most notably with David Kramer, his family life, and his tragic death and its aftermath. In this pioneering biography of one of Cape Towns most beloved entertainers, we encounter Petersen as a complex and many-sided personality whose influence continues to reverberate in national life.<br> Mr Entertainment evokes not just Talieps life, but also the music and entertainment landscapes of the 1950s to 2000s and their diverse and irrepressible cultural traditions. Along the way, it brings us to the front row of South Africas difficult history.Drawing on the musicians personal archive and on more than fifty interviews conducted over a decade, Paula Fourie has pieced together a fascinating portrait of Taliep Petersen, acutely observed and poignantly captured.</p>
